Textile company goes into voluntary liquidation

A Clarke Bell Corporate Case Study

The UK textile industry has been hit hard in recent years, with a number of companies forced out of business due to financial pressures caused by difficult trading conditions. However, one Mansfield-based company is facing a promising future as a result of legal and financial arrangements organised by Manchester Chartered Accountants and Insolvency Practitioners Clarke Bell.

In common with many UK designers and manufacturers, Lorien Textiles' business became unviable due to the cumulative effects of the strength of the pound, cost pressures and demands for ever keener prices on the High Street. This eventually resulted in the business being taken into voluntary liquidation.

Fortunately, Lorien turned to Clarke Bell for help and, as a result, a new company trading as Lorien Lingerie and Lorien Nightware was formed, with products now being sourced from Lithuania and China.

The new company has re-employed a number of design and packaging staff, and is back in business supplying among others well-known High Street retailers such as Mackays, New Look and Etam.

"The advice and guidance we received from Clarke Bell was invaluable in making these arrangements," said Lorien's Managing Director Peter Robinson.

"Unlike some other declining industries, we were largely on our own when our problems worsened, so it was a great help to find professional support and expertise when we needed it most.

Clarke Bell were very positive all through and helped us make the best of the situation."

"Sometimes Business liquidation is the best option for a company in difficulties," commented John Bell, Clarke Bell Senior Partner.

"But it's important for company owners and directors to realise that business assets, expertise and order books can often be saved through the formation of a new company. With the right entrepreneurial skills and good professional advice, businesses like Lorien can become successful again."
